# Lanternhook — Environments

Three environments: dev, staging, prod. All sit behind the Corvette load balancer. Health checks hit the probe endpoint every few seconds; two consecutive failures pull a node from rotation. Staging mirrors prod except for tighter timeouts. Don't tune probes per-node — change the shared config. Current prod values below.

deployment values, fahap-hahaf:
[casdor]
port = 9200
region = south-2
host = casdor.qirvanworks.corp
timeout_ms = 3000
retries = 4

# -----------------------------------------------
# Sheetgate CSV Import Wizard — reviewer notes
#
# Uploads are scanned, size-capped at 50 MB, and
# parsed in a sandboxed worker. Formula cells are
# stripped before staging. Temp files purge after
# 24h. Audit events go to the intake log. The
# wizard stages validated rows into the imports
# database using the connection string below.

replica DSN, kajep-yahag: mssql://praok_svc:iF@db-8d68.plorvaio.local:5432/eliion

☐ Ceremony step 4: Re-key the VerdantBay greenhouse controller. Confirm temperature and humidity sensors show drift under 0.3 units after calibration. Export the drift-offset table. Two support staff witness and sign. Seal old keys in the envelope; shred working notes. Controller will reboot once and prompt for the recovery passphrase, which is given below.

unlock words, yawig-kagef: gordor-holvan-ulaael-pramir-ulaiel-tamdor

## Sensor drift: what to do at 3am

If the GrowLoop controller starts reporting humidity swings that don't match the backup probes in the Fernwick greenhouse, it's almost always sensor drift, not an actual climate event. Don't panic and don't touch the vents manually. First, restart the calibration daemon and give it ten minutes to re-baseline. If readings still disagree by more than 5%, flip the controller into safe mode. The safe-mode thresholds it will use are these.

config for yahap-bajof:
[istix]
host = istix.qorvelsys.internal
user = istix_svc
database = istix_prod